Tips for Preventing Hearing Aid Dome Itch

Experiencing itchiness around your hearing aid domes can be a real nuisance. But don't stress, there are several things you can implement to prevent and alleviate this common problem. First, make sure you are cleaning your hearing aids daily as recommended by your audiologist. This helps remove wax which can contribute to itchiness. You should also consider alternating your domes at least to avoid irritation from prolonged wear. Moisturizing the area around your ears with a gentle lotion or cream can also provide some relief.

  • Refrain from harsh soaps and detergents when bathing your ears as they can dry out the skin.
  • Keep your hearing aids moisture-free to prevent fungal growth, which can cause itching.
  • Consult your audiologist if you experience persistent or severe itching. They may recommend medications to address the issue.

Finding Relief From Hearing Aid Itch: Dr. Goldberg's Advice

Experiencing itching or irritation around your ears after wearing hearing aids is a common issue. Luckily, Dr. Goldberg has some helpful recommendations to bring you relief. One of the most important things to do is ensure your hearing aids match properly. Ill-fitting devices can chafe against your skin, causing itchiness. Dr. Goldberg recommends inspecting your hearing aids regularly for any indications of a poor alignment.

  • Moreover, try cleaning your ears and the surface around your hearing aids daily. This can help remove any residue that may be contributing to the itch.
  • Additionally, Dr. Goldberg suggests using a hypoallergenic cream on the affected region of your skin. This can help calm any inflammation.
